https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=26381 Bug ID: 26381 Summary: Koha should provide Koha plugins with a template to use with Template::Toolkit WRAPPER Change sponsored?: --- Product: Koha Version: master Hardware: All OS: All Status: NEW Severity: enhancement Priority: P5 - low Component: Plugin architecture Assignee: koha-bugs@lists.koha-community.org Reporter: dcook@prosentient.com.au QA Contact: testopia@bugs.koha-community.org At the moment, Koha plugins have to built their own templates from scratch. I'm proposing that Koha provides a BLOCK or a template file that Koha plugins can then use with the Template::Toolkit WRAPPER directive to minimize the amount of boiler plate they have to use. Here is an example of a very simple "plugin_wrapper" [% BLOCK plugin_wrapper %] [% INCLUDE 'doc-head-open.inc' %] <title>Koha: [% name %]</title> [% INCLUDE 'doc-head-close.inc' %] </head> <body> [% INCLUDE 'header.inc' %] [% INCLUDE 'cat-search.inc' %] <div id="breadcrumbs"><a href="/cgi-bin/koha/mainpage.pl">Home</a> › <a href="/cgi-bin/koha/plugins/plugins-home.pl">Plugins</a> › [% breadcrumb %]</div> <div id="doc3"> [% content %] [% INCLUDE 'intranet-bottom.inc' %] [% END %] Then, in my report-step1.tt file, all I need to include is the following: [% WRAPPER plugin_wrapper name = 'My Plugin' breadcrumb = 'My Plugin' %] <div>Plugin content</div> [% END %] I've already tested this a little bit, and it's beautiful.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ug. https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=26381 --- Comment #3 from David Cook <dcook@prosentient.com.au> --- (In reply to David Cook from comment #2)
I think that I could also be happy with Koha plugin specific wrappers, so long as they could be reusable within the same plugin.
I need to play with the INCLUDE directive a bit to see whether or not Koha needs to be patched to add include directories for plugins...
Here's a solution: MyPlugin.pm: my $template = $self->get_template({ file => 'report-step1.tt' }); my $wrapper = $self->mbf_path('wrapper.tt'); $template->param( plugin_wrapper => $wrapper, ); report-step1.tt: [% WRAPPER $plugin_wrapper name = 'My Plugin' breadcrumb = 'My Plugin' %] <div>Plugin content</div> [% END %] Excellent! There's other ways we could do this, but that worked pretty well.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ug. You are watching all bug changes.
